Zainab’s murderer makes startling revelations
LAHORE: An anti-terrorism court judge, Sajjad Ahmad, on Wednesday handed over the alleged rapist and murderer of seven-year-old Zainab to the police on 14-day physical remand to probe similar cases of other minor girls.
The suspect, Imran Ali, was produced before the ATC amid tight security. His face was covered with a black cloth when the police brought him to the courtroom. Later, it was removed on the judge’s order.
The judge asked the police whether there were one or two accused, to which the investigation officer (IO) replied that there was one. The judge, after seeing the suspect’s face, said whether it was the same person seen in the CCTV footage. The IO replied in the affirmative.
He further asked the man seen in the CCTV footage had beard but the accused produced before the court had none. The IO said the accused had admitted that he had shaved off his beard after murdering Zainab.
The judge also inquired whether the police had any evidence of his involvement in the case, the IO contended that the DNA report was attached with the documents, which matched with that of Zainab.
When asked if the police had any other proof, the IO said a polygraph test of the accused was also conducted which established his involvement. The judge said what was the legal value of the polygraph, to which the IO replied that the court could summon senior officials who conducted the test for testifying its results.
The IO said the DNA test was conducted on January 20 and the report normally took one or two days. He prayed the court for seeking 14 days of physical remand of the accused on the plea to investigate the cases of other minor girls who had been abducted, raped and killed allegedly by the same accused.
The police official said minor girl Kainat, who is hospitalised in Children’s Hospital Lahore, was also targeted by Imran as his DNA matched with her. He said the police were yet to investigate where the accused had taken the minors to rape and kill them.
About the incident, the IO said Kainat, along with her brother, was going for a class to learn Quran, but the accused lured her before she entered the house. The IO told the court that Imran used to give candies to the minors for trapping them. Later, the court granted 14-day physical remand with the directions to produce Imran again on February 7 along with the investigation report till that date.
Meanwhile, sources say the accused told the JIT that he kidnapped Zainab at around 6:45pm and kept moving around for over 1.5 kilometres because of not finding a suitable place. The room in which he kept Zainab was without electricity and packets of biryani found from there had her fingerprints, they added.
The accused used to kidnap girls from the houses where he worked, the sources said and added that Imran abducted Kainat on the pretext of giving her yogurt. He told the investigators that he raped and murdered a total of 10 girls – eight in under-construction houses and two at garbage dumping places. However, his involvement has been proved in eight cases only, as the DNA samples of two girls were spoiled.
On the other hand, BBC reported that the police managed to arrest Imran with the help two buttons of his jacket. The CCTV footage showed a person wearing a jacket which had two large visible buttons and the police found that in a raid at his house.
